Hardware: Microsoft Surface Pro 4, 4gb/128gb nvme drive
Expected Behaviour: Pen/Touch function
Actual Behaviour: Pen/Touch do not work or respond to anything
Kernel/Ubuntu Versions: All
Cause: Hardware requires IPTS (Intel Precision Touch & Stylus) to function. This is because touch processing is accelerated by the Intel Skylake GPU.
IPTS driver can be found here: https://github.com/ipts-linux-org/ipts-linux-new/wiki
Kernel compile under Debian with other Surface-specific patches can be found here: https://github.com/jimdigriz/debian-mssp4
On Reddit there are some custom kernels floating around with support patched in: https://www.reddit.com/r/SurfaceLinux/comments/4t64zt/getting_the_sp4_running_with_ubuntu_1604/
Hardware: Microsoft Surface Pro 4, 4gb/128gb nvme drive
Expected Behaviour: Pen/Touch function
Actual Behaviour: Pen/Touch do not work or respond to anything
Kernel/Ubuntu Versions: All
Cause: Hardware requires IPTS (Intel Precision Touch & Stylus) to function. This is because touch processing is accelerated by the Intel Skylake GPU.
IPTS driver can be found here: https:/ /github. com/ipts- linux-org/ ipts-linux- new/wiki
Kernel compile under Debian with other Surface-specific patches can be found here: https:/ /github. com/jimdigriz/ debian- mssp4
On Reddit there are some custom kernels floating around with support patched in: https:/ /www.reddit. com/r/SurfaceLi nux/comments/ 4t64zt/ getting_ the_sp4_ running_ with_ubuntu_ 1604/